Transaction e584537e633b426c32097a775666b01712cd44b63f5f67749949f9f6d3e9619d
1 Input
1 Output
-
e584537e633b426c32097a775666b01712cd44b63f5f67749949f9f6d3e9619d:0
- value
- 508498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 534ee7be553a020d39be2345c41b011afc1077cd OP_EQUAL
- address
- 39HWXu4YoJ1MKQnC41Ygpq46gDhEX7aWKC